Utah Jazz Golden State Warriors recap final score highlights

Utah Jazz struggled against the Warriors, with Markkanen and young players facing challenges. Tough loss, but valuable learning experience for the team.

The Utah Jazz had a tough night on the basketball court, facing off against the formidable Golden State Warriors. Steph Curry, Draymond Green, and Klay Thompson were in top form, leading the Warriors to a 129-107 victory over the Jazz.

Lauri Markkanen, in particular, had a difficult time, scoring 19 points and grabbing 5 rebounds. The Warriors' strong lineup of wings and forwards, including Andrew Wiggins, Jonathan Kuminga, and Draymond Green, made it challenging for Markkanen to find his rhythm. The Jazz will need to find new ways to get Markkanen involved in the game in future matchups against the Warriors.

It's important to note that Markkanen is now getting more opportunities to improve his game. While he currently relies on his teammates to set him up for success, he will need to become more independent if the Jazz are to have a shot at a championship. The team faced a tough opponent in the Warriors, who demonstrated their contender status. This game highlighted the level of skill and toughness required to compete in the playoffs.

The Jazz also made some surprising lineup changes, starting Keyonte George at point guard. While George showed flashes of potential, he struggled to find his shot and had the challenging task of defending against Steph Curry. His ability to learn and grow from experiences like this will be crucial for his future and the success of the Jazz.

Another significant development was the increased playing time for Taylor Hendricks. While he showed promise, it was evident that he is still raw and learning how to contribute at the NBA level. The Jazz are investing in their young players, knowing that the experience gained now will pay off in the long run.

Despite the dejection felt in the locker room after the game, the Jazz are committed to developing their young talent. The team understands that there will be painful losses in the short term, but they are focused on building a tough-minded group that can overcome adversity. The long-term benefits of investing in their young players and maintaining a solid group of veterans will ultimately determine the success of the Jazz.
